ABSTRACT

Diabetes peripheral neuropathy (DNP) is a chronic complication of peripheral nerve injury caused by long-term onset of diabetes. In recent years, with the in-depth study of Chinese medicine in diabetes peripheral neuropathy, Buyang Huanwu Decoction has made some progress in its treatment. This article studies the mechanism and clinical efficacy of Buyang Huanwu Decoction on diabetes peripheral neuropathy, and provides a new method for the treatment of diabetes peripheral neuropathy.
